NAPPH Surveys Report Negative Results of Psychiatric Case Management

OPEN MINDS The Behavioral Health & Social Service Industry Analyst Industry News The National Association of Private Psychiatric Hospitals (NAPPH) recently released the results, of a survey of 94 member hospitals on their experiences with psychiatric case management. The survey results included: 42%: Psychiatric case management companies rarely explain their review criteria 52%: Review criteria are inconsistently applied 58%: Experienced problems with reviewers not having adequate qualifications for psychiatric cases 62%: Case managers demand discharge too early For information on the survey, contact Carole Szpak NAPPH, 1319 F Str . . .
